Allergies in newborns can be a cause of concern for many parents. It is important to understand that allergies can develop in infants due to a variety of factors, including genetics, environmental factors, and the introduction of new foods or formulas. Common allergens that can trigger allergic reactions in newborns include cow’s milk, soy, nuts, eggs, and wheat. Symptoms of allergies in newborns can range from mild to severe and may include skin rashes, hives, eczema, vomiting, diarrhea, and difficulty breathing. It is important for parents to be aware of the signs of allergies in newborns and to seek medical attention if they suspect their baby may be experiencing an allergic reaction.
